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10151036 44659 33499 435226 026163818
3309025 21411
3309025 21411
3702 00193 57
All about undefined
Interested in learning more?
3309025 21411
3702 00193 57
See more
42 8965 00873003
004 870167943 52 2351 829948
See more
091962 428233626 170
264386369 47647 378366
See more